Situated on the "knob", a famous Colorado high country outcropping, "honeycombed
with gold and silver", at the crest of Sheridan Pass (now Red Mountain Pass),
the mine was served by Otto Mear's Silverton Railroad, "The Rainbow Route".
It's silver ore was worth up to $14,000 per ton! Hopefully the diggin's on your
railroad will be equally as good!

Actually, C. C. Crow scratchbuilt a model over 20 years ago, we have researched
the prototype (as well as visited the site), and we are now working on the kit
version and diorama. The mine features the distinctive board and batten headframe
(or shafthouse), with attached clapboard boilerhouse/hoist shed to the right,
sorting/sample shed to the left, separate hoist house and additional sheds. But
that's just the half of it! Check out the prototype photo above. There's a whole
other section below! We're including the covered ore bins and snowshed-style
mine entrance, exposed so you can see the mine cars and other details inside.
